Job Summary

Manages a team of professional Configuration Analysts. Responsible for operational activities for the assigned team, including accurate and timely implementation and maintenance of critical information on claims databases. Validate data to be housed on databases and ensure adherence to business and system requirements of Health Plans as it pertains to contracting, benefits, prior authorizations, fee schedules, and other business requirements.
